Sharolyn Petty Wood Tues 04 June 2002
Daniel D. Hassell (1815-1876) moved from Anderson Co to Navarro before 1870. He was a son of Zacheus and Phebe Parker Hassell and grandson of "Elder" John Parker. Daniel and his 2nd wf Mary are buried at Prairie Point Cem., with daughter Julia (d. 1875) and son Ben (d. 1872). Other sources indicate headstone dates for Daniel and Ben may be inaccurate. Daniel's 1st wife was Julia Ann Duke. Their children: Charity, George W., Mary E., Darcus M., Charles, Julia A. and Ben. Appreciate information on these children and information on Nancy Westbrooks Hassell (b. 1850).

Mrs Grimm Wed 17 April 2002
My father was CAID CARSON, listed as contractor of the crematory built in Corsicana. Am interested in exact location of this building and any other information on construction. My father designed and built incinerators during the 1920s-1930s in many locations in Texas and throughout the U. S. This may be one of the last remaining.
